html{font-size:62.5%}body,ul,li,p,h1,h2,h3,h4,h5,dt,dd,dl{margin:0;padding:0;font-family:Microsoft YaHei}body{background:url(../images/bg.jpg) repeat-y center}a{font-family:Microsoft YaHei;text-decoration:none}img{border:0}ul,li{list-style:none}header{width:100%;background:#fff}img.logo{width:100%;margin:0 auto;padding:1rem 0}img.banner{width:100%;margin:0 auto}section.container{width:100%;margin:0 auto}footer{width:100%;background:#f3f2f3;text-align:center;font-size:1.2rem;color:#66696a;padding:1rem 0;line-height:1.5rem}.tit2{width:90%;margin:1rem auto 0}.tit2 li{display:inline-block}.st1_1{background:url(../images/a1_1.png) no-repeat;background-size:100%;background-position:center;width:50%;height:7rem}.st2_1{background:url(../images/a2_2.png) no-repeat;background-size:100%;background-position:center;width:50%;height:7rem}.st1_2{background:url(../images/a1_2.png) no-repeat;background-size:100%;background-position:center;width:50%;height:7rem}.st2_2{background:url(../images/a2_1.png) no-repeat;background-size:100%;background-position:center;width:50%;height:7rem}.bbox{background:#ea7603;width:90%;margin:0 auto;border:5px solid #fb830b;border-top-left-radius:10px;border-top-right-radius:10px;padding-bottom:1rem}.bbox>li{font-size:1.6rem;text-align:center;color:#810b16}.bbox>li>span{color:#fef301;font-size:3rem}.bbox>h4{color:#810b16;font-size:3rem;text-align:center}.bbox>p{width:75%;text-align:left;margin:0 auto;color:#810b16;font-size:1.4rem;line-height:1.8rem}.bbox>a>dd{width:70%;margin:1rem auto;color:#ff8103;text-align:center;font-size:2rem;padding:5px 0;border-radius:3rem;background:-moz-linear-gradient(top,#a00311,#3757fa);background:-webkit-gradient(linear,left top,left bottom,color-stop(0,#a00311),color-stop(1,#d20316))}.bbox>a>dd>em{color:#000;font-style:normal}.planeline{background:#ea7603;width:90%;margin:0 auto;border:5px solid #fb830b;margin-top:5px}hgroup.hgroup3{width:100%;padding:3rem 0 1rem 0;position:relative}.gp{width:100%;margin:1rem auto;text-align:center;background:#f4a72e;font-size:2rem;line-height:3rem;color:#fff}table{width:98%;margin:0 auto 1rem}td{font-size:1.4rem;color:#000;line-height:2rem;border:1px solid #ff980c;width:22%;text-align:center;background:#ffe9d3}td:nth-child(1),td:nth-child(2){border-right:0}td:nth-child(2),td:nth-child(3){border-left:0}tr:nth-child(2n){background:#fff}tr:nth-child(1)>td{background:#ffad38;height:3rem;font-size:1.4rem;font-weight:bold}.table2{width:100%}.table2 tr td{font-size:1.2rem;color:#000;line-height:2rem;border:1px solid #000}.table2 tr td:nth-child(1){width:30%}.table2 tr td:nth-child(2){width:70%}.detail{width:90%;margin:1rem auto}.detail{font-size:1.2rem;color:#fff;line-height:1.6rem}ul.con_ul{width:95%;margin:1rem auto}.con_ul li{border-radius:5px;font-size:1.8rem;display:inline-block;text-align:center;color:#512193;line-height:3rem;font-weight:bold;margin:1%;background:#81030e;padding:5px 1rem;color:#ea7603}li.hoverli{position:relative;z-index:2;background:#0cbfed;color:#000}.mhotels{width:95%;margin:0 auto;display:none}.tion2{display:none}.mhotels2{width:95%;margin:0 auto;display:none}.p_wz{text-align:right;color:#fff;font-size:1.2rem;text-decoration:underline;line-height:2rem;padding-top:1rem}.hide1,.hide2,.hide3,.hide4{display:none}@media screen and (min-width:210px) and (max-width:300px){html{font-size:50%}}@media screen and (min-width:301px) and (max-width:349px){html{font-size:56.3%}.bbox>li{font-size:1.4rem}.con_ul li{font-size:1.4rem}.detail{font-size:1.4rem}}@media screen and (min-width:350px) and (max-width:374px){.bbox>li{font-size:1.4rem}.con_ul li{font-size:1.4rem}.detail{font-size:1.4rem}}@media screen and (min-width:641px) and (max-width:699px){.st1_1{height:10rem}.st2_1{height:10rem}.st1_2{height:10rem}.st2_2{height:10rem}}@media screen and (min-width:700px) and (max-width:767px){.st1_1{height:10rem}.st2_1{height:10rem}.st1_2{height:10rem}.st2_2{height:10rem}}@media screen and (min-width:768px) and (max-width:1024px){html{font-size:81.3%}.st1_1{height:10rem}.st2_1{height:10rem}.st1_2{height:10rem}.st2_2{height:10rem}}@media screen and (min-width:1025px) and (max-width:1280px){html{font-size:75%}}@media screen and (min-width:1281px) and (max-width:1920px){html{font-size:150%}}@media screen and (min-width:1921px) and (max-width:2561px){html{font-size:200%}}